Abstract EN
Objective.
To validate the ability of 99mTc-Annexin V to visualize early stage of glucocorticoid-induced femoral head necrosis by comparing with 99mTc-MDP bone scanning.
Methods.
Femoral head necrosis was induced in adult New Zealand white rabbits by intramuscular injection of methylprednisolone.
99mTc-Annexin scintigraphy and 99mTc-MDP scans were performed before and 5, 6, and 8 weeks after methylprednisolone administration.
Rabbits were sacrificed at various time points and conducted for TUNEL and H&E staining.
Results.
All methylprednisolone treated animals developed femoral head necrosis; at 8 weeks postinjection, destruction of bone structure was evident in H&E staining, and apoptosis was confirmed by the TUNEL assay.
This was matched by 99mTc-Annexin V images, which showed a significant increase in signal over baseline.
Serial 99mTc-Annexin V scans revealed that increased 99mTc-Annexin V uptake could be observed in 5 weeks.
In contrast, there was no effect on 99mTc-MDP signal until 8 weeks.
The TUNEL assay revealed that bone cell apoptosis occurred at 5 weeks.
Conclusion.
99mTc-Annexin V is superior to 99mTc-MDP for the early detection of glucocorticoid-induced femoral head necrosis in the rabbit and may be a better strategy for the early detection of glucocorticoid-induced femoral head necrosis in patients.
